Character from Sword Art Online by Reki Kawahara
The Underworld's rebel system administrator — a copy of Quinella who chose to be her opposite, living alone in a library for two hundred years, waiting for someone to help her fix the world.
Cardinal is what happens when a system designed to maintain balance gains consciousness and discovers the system is broken. She was created when Quinella attempted to absorb the Cardinal System's error-checking subroutine and it fought back, producing a separate consciousness that inherited the system's directive to correct errors — with Quinella as Error Number One. She spent two hundred years alone in the Great Library, unable to leave because Quinella's power exceeded hers in direct combat, compiling knowledge and waiting for allies. She is patient, brilliant, and deeply sad in the way that immortal beings trapped in futile situations become sad. She views the Underworld's inhabitants as her children — she was supposed to protect them, and she's been failing for centuries. Her sacrifice — choosing to die so that others could fight Quinella — was not a sudden decision but the culmination of two hundred years of acceptance.
Appears as a small girl in a dark red robe, with round glasses and long brown hair. She looks like a librarian's apprentice, which is both deliberate and misleading — she contains the processing power of an entire world's operating system in a body she chose to keep unintimidating.
